【考案の詳細な説明】
(産業上の利用分野)
この考案は、水槽底部に敷くことによつて底床
内の水循環、底床の保温、底床への肥料の注入を
行ない水草を育てやすくする器具に関するもので
ある。[Detailed explanation of the invention] (Field of industrial application) This invention facilitates the growth of aquatic plants by placing it at the bottom of the aquarium to circulate water within the substrate, keep the substrate warm, and inject fertilizer into the substrate. It relates to equipment for
(従来の技術)
従来の底面濾過器では、肥料を底床へ添加する
と水の循環と共に肥料を水中へ吸い出して水を汚
すし、水が富栄養化するため苔が発生して水草を
だめにしてしまうことが多い。(Conventional technology) With conventional bottom filters, when fertilizer is added to the substrate, the fertilizer is sucked out into the water as the water circulates, polluting the water, and the water becomes eutrophic, causing moss to grow and spoiling aquatic plants. I often end up.
また従来の線状や板状の電熱ヒーターでは、底
床が温まりすぎるという欠点がある。 Furthermore, conventional linear or plate-shaped electric heaters have the disadvantage that the bottom floor becomes too warm.
また従来、肥料の効果がなくなる毎に、水草を
引き抜いて砂利を洗い古くなつた肥料を取り除き
新しい肥料を添加して水草を植え直すといつた一
連の作業を繰り返さなければならない。 Conventionally, whenever the effect of fertilizer wears off, a series of tasks must be repeated, such as pulling out the aquatic plants, washing the gravel, removing old fertilizer, adding new fertilizer, and replanting the aquatic plants.
液体の水中添加肥料もあるが水を富栄養化する
ため苔が発生しやすく、その使用方法には経験を
要する。 There are also liquid fertilizers that can be added to water, but since they eutrophicate the water, they tend to grow moss, so experience is required to know how to use them.
(考案が解決しようとする課題)
本案は、これらの欠点を解消して技術を要する
ことなくわずかな管理をするだけで簡単に水草を
育成することができるようにするために考案され
たものである。(Problem to be solved by the invention) This invention was devised in order to eliminate these drawbacks and make it possible to easily grow aquatic plants with only a little management without requiring any skill. be.
(課題を解決するための手段)
以下その構成を図面を追いながら説明すると、
(イ) 厚さ1〜3ミリ位のプラスチツク板で作られ
た高さ7〜10ミリ程度(幅や長さについては制
限は無い)の板状の箱(底板は無くてもよい)
の上面全体に直径1〜1.5ミリ程度の小穴5を
1センチ位の間隔であけた底面箱1。(Means for solving the problem) The structure will be explained below with reference to the drawings. (There are no restrictions) (the bottom plate may be omitted)
A bottom box 1 with small holes 5 of about 1 to 1.5 mm in diameter made at intervals of about 1 cm throughout the top surface.
(ロ) 底面箱1の角の方に底面箱1の内部に通じる
パイプ差込み口3を設け、そこに中空パイプ4
をはめ込む。(b) A pipe insertion port 3 leading to the inside of the bottom box 1 is provided at the corner of the bottom box 1, and a hollow pipe 4 is inserted therein.
Insert.
(ハ) 底面箱1の上面に均一に行きわたるように配
管した中空パイプ2を底面箱1の上面に取付
け、中空パイプ2の上部には直径1〜1.5ミリ
程度の小穴8を5センチ位の間隔で一列にあけ
る。(c) Attach a hollow pipe 2 to the top of the bottom box 1 so that it spreads uniformly over the top of the bottom box 1, and make a small hole 8 with a diameter of about 1 to 1.5 mm about 5 cm in the top of the hollow pipe 2. Space them in a row.
(ニ) 中空パイプ2の両端にそれぞれパイプ差込み
口6を設け、どちらか一方に中空パイプ7をは
め込む。(中空パイプ7は、排水口9付近で直
角に曲げる。)
(作用)
本案は以上のような構成であるからこれを使用
するときは、
中空パイプ4の長さは、水槽に水を入れた時に
水面より2センチ位、肥料注入口10が上に出る
ように調整する。(d) Pipe insertion ports 6 are provided at both ends of the hollow pipe 2, and the hollow pipe 7 is fitted into either end. (The hollow pipe 7 is bent at a right angle near the drain port 9.) (Function) Since the proposed structure is as described above, when using this, the length of the hollow pipe 4 is the same as the length of the water in the tank. Adjust so that the fertilizer inlet 10 is about 2 cm above the water surface.
中空パイプ7は、排水口9が水面以下にあるよ
うにする。 The hollow pipe 7 has a drain port 9 located below the water surface.
次に吸水口11に穴あきパイプ12を付け、そ
こにスポンジ13をはめ込んだ小型水中ポンプ1
4の排水口15をパイプ差込み口6に取付ける。 Next, a small submersible pump 1 with a perforated pipe 12 attached to the water intake port 11 and a sponge 13 inserted therein.
Attach the drain port 15 of No. 4 to the pipe insertion port 6.
以上の如く構成された、水槽内水草育成用底床
器具を水槽の底に敷きその上に2〜3ミリ位の大
きさの砂利を5〜7センチの厚さになるように被
せて、水を入れ砂利中に水草を植え込み小型水中
ポンプ14を作動させるとスポンジ13中を通つ
て濾過された水が、小型水中ポンプ14によつて
中空パイプ2中に送り込まれ、若干の水が小穴8
から砂利中に噴き出し、大部分は中空パイプ7中
を経て排水口9より排水される。 Place the substrate device for growing aquatic plants in an aquarium constructed as above on the bottom of the aquarium, cover it with gravel of about 2 to 3 mm in size to a thickness of 5 to 7 cm, and then water it. When aquatic plants are planted in the gravel and the small submersible pump 14 is activated, the water filtered through the sponge 13 is sent into the hollow pipe 2 by the small submersible pump 14, and some water flows into the small hole 8.
Most of the water is ejected into the gravel through the hollow pipe 7 and drained from the drain port 9.
こうして水がきれいに澄むまでこのままにして
おき、水が澄んだところで肥料注入口10より肥
料を注入して完成となる。 This is left until the water becomes clear, and once the water becomes clear, fertilizer is injected through the fertilizer inlet 10 to complete the process.
(実施例)
本考案の実施に当たつて次の如きことができ
る。(Example) In implementing the present invention, the following can be done.
(イ)小穴5を線状のすきまにしたもの。(a) The small hole 5 has a linear gap.
(ロ)小穴8を線状のすきまにしたもの。(b) The small hole 8 has a linear gap.
(ハ)小穴8をあけないもの。(c) Items that do not have small holes 8.
(考案の効果) 本考案には、次のような効果がある。(Effect of idea) The present invention has the following effects.
(イ) 中空パイプ2中に水を循環させることによつ
て底床の保温を行ない茎、葉と根との間の温度
差をなくす。なお、水槽内の水によつての保温
のため温めすぎることもない。(a) By circulating water in the hollow pipe 2, the substrate is kept warm and the temperature difference between the stems, leaves and roots is eliminated. Additionally, the water in the tank keeps it warm so it doesn't get too warm.
(ロ) 小穴8より若干の水を砂利中に噴出させるこ
とにより根に酸素を供給し、根腐れを防ぐ。(b) A small amount of water is squirted into the gravel from the small holes 8 to supply oxygen to the roots and prevent root rot.
(ハ) 中空パイプ4から肥料の注入を行ない、また
中空パイプ4にホースを取付けて排水すること
によつて古くなつた肥料を取り除くことができ
る。したがつて肥料の入れ替えが簡単になる。(c) Old fertilizer can be removed by injecting fertilizer through the hollow pipe 4 and draining it by attaching a hose to the hollow pipe 4. Therefore, replacing fertilizer becomes easy.
(ニ) 底面箱1の内部に肥料をためることにより根
に直接養分を供給し、水を富栄養化しにくくし
て苔の発生を防ぐ。(d) By storing fertilizer inside the bottom box 1, nutrients are supplied directly to the roots, making it difficult for the water to become eutrophic and preventing the growth of moss.
